Set against the backdrop of modern-day Mumbai, “The Virgin Tree” unfolds as a heartfelt exploration of love and acceptance in the face of societal norms and expectations. At its core, the film follows the story of Aarav, a young man grappling with his identity and desires amidst the complexities of urban life. Drawn to Meera, a free-spirited artist with a zest for life, Aarav finds himself entangled in a whirlwind romance that challenges his beliefs and perceptions.
As their relationship blossoms, Aarav confronts his inner conflicts and societal pressures, navigating the blurred lines between tradition and personal freedom. With themes of self-acceptance and cultural acceptance interwoven throughout the narrative, “The Virgin Tree” offers a nuanced portrayal of love in all its forms, transcending boundaries of gender and convention.
